Upon arriving at River Shore City, Yohan flew directly toward the Lin Clan manor and touched down. Moments later, Aira and Aella landed behind him, having followed his lead through the air.

Aira’s expression remained bitter following her earlier encounter with Yohan. Internally, she was seething, her pride wounded by the humiliation he had dealt her.

"Home sweet home! There is no place I cherish more than this," Yohan remarked, glancing back at the two women. Aella offered him a gentle smile in response, but Aira stayed silent. She was clearly irritated by Yohan’s relaxed demeanor; he looked perfectly composed, acting as though the conflict between them had never occurred.

Noticing her coldness, Yohan sighed and stepped toward Aira. As he closed the distance, Aella watched him with a troubled gaze, her eyes tracking his every move.

"What is it you want?" Aira asked, her voice trembling slightly. She was deeply confused by his intentions as he came to a halt only inches away from her.

‘What is our next move? I have a terrible feeling about this! Tell me what to do—does he suspect our true goals? I suspect he is just stalling for time. We should strike together right now rather than waiting for reinforcements. It will take days for backup to reach this location!’ Aira frantically sent a mental transmission to Aella. She was convinced Yohan hadn't bought their cover story and had only brought them here to avoid fighting them without the Sect's support.

Aira’s mind raced with dark thoughts, the lingering sensation of his grip on her neck still fresh and haunting.

‘Do not act... just remain still!’ Aella’s command echoed in Aira’s mind. Though shocked by the instruction, Aira forced herself to stay composed and hide her agitation.

"Why are you staring at me like that? I already told you it was just a test. I had no real intention of harming you; I simply took my little evaluation a bit too far..." Aira stammered, beads of sweat forming on her brow.

"There’s no need to keep explaining yourself. I'm aware of your intentions. Aunt Aella already clarified the situation, and I’ve moved past what happened between us," Yohan replied, seeing how worked up she was. His words only left Aira looking more bewildered.

"Then what are you trying to do..." she whispered.

"Just stay still and trust me. I’m simply fixing the damage I caused earlier," Yohan said. Suddenly, his palm came to rest against her neck. Aira’s eyes went wide at the touch of his gentle hand, and even Aella, standing a few meters away, was stunned by the sudden gesture.

"What are you—" Before she could finish, a warm, soothing sensation flooded her body. A faint green glow emanated from where Yohan’s palm met her skin. The bruising on her neck began to vanish as if by magic, and the lingering ache faded away. Aella watched in pure disbelief as Aira was healed instantly before her eyes.

After a moment, Yohan retracted his hand, revealing her porcelain skin. The injury was gone, leaving no trace that anything had happened.

"How did you manage that?" Aella rushed over to inspect Aira’s neck. It was flawless, showing no signs of trauma.

"Just a small technique I developed through my own insights," Yohan answered with a smirk, choosing not to reveal the secrets of his unique Cultivation abilities. He then added, "I’d prefer my family not to see you in such a state. You should be more cautious; you never know what kind of demons people hide within themselves."

"..."

The two women were left speechless. In that instant, Yohan’s cheerful mask had slipped, replaced by a serious expression and eyes as cold as ice.

"Anyway, I'll see you both later. It's getting late, and I need to go see Jasmine; she's expecting me," Yohan announced. With those words, he vanished, leaving them standing alone in front of the Lin Clan manor.

"I can't wrap my head around him. He is utterly unpredictable... and that healing ability? I've never seen anything like it in my life!" Aira cried out to Aella the moment Yohan was gone. Aella let out a heavy sigh, her face etched with concern.

"His ability to heal is indeed shocking. He claims it's just a trick from his own understanding, but between his monstrous growth and this... I suspect Evelyn knows the truth. There is so much at stake here; it’s no wonder she chose him over the Imperial Order," Aella whispered, her expression grim.

"What is our plan? He’s bound to figure everything out eventually. Once he realizes why we’ve truly come, he’ll make our lives miserable. We’ll be trapped in enemy territory if we don't act quickly!" Aira looked at Aella anxiously. Their attempt to intimidate Yohan with their strength had failed, and now that Evelyn knew their true motives, Aira knew the woman would likely retaliate soon.

"Let's move. I need to dispatch an urgent report to the Imperial Family immediately!" Aella declared, gesturing for Aira to follow. Aira nodded, seeing the urgency in Aella's eyes, and the two quickly departed.

Meanwhile, Yohan reappeared inside his private quarters, his face darkening with frustration.

'It's just one endless cycle of trouble. Conflict always finds its way to my doorstep. I thought I'd finally have a moment of peace after the mess at the Nichole Clan territory, but now this,' Yohan thought bitterly.

"The Imperial Family... what the hell do they want with me?" Yohan muttered before calling out, "System, replay the conversation between those two. I want to hear exactly what they said through their spiritual senses again."
